Hashmap foreach java 8
Web打印Java ConcurrentHashMap中的所有键/值对 java collections 老实说,输出结果很奇怪,可能是我的程序不正确,但我首先要确定这部分是我想要使用的 for (Entry entry : wordCountMap.entrySet()) { String key = entry.getKey().toString(); Inte WebConcurrentHashMap (Java Platform SE 8 ) Class ConcurrentHashMap java.lang.Object java.util.AbstractMap java.util.concurrent.ConcurrentHashMap Type Parameters: K - the type of keys maintained by this map V - the type of mapped values All Implemented Interfaces: …
Hashmap foreach java 8
Did you know?
WebApr 10, 2024 · (1)方式一:键找值 先获取Map集合的全部键的Set集合。 遍历键的Set集合,然后通过键提取对应值。 涉及API: (2)方式二:键值对 先把Map集合转换成Set集合,Set集合中每个元素都是键值对实现类型了。 遍历Set集合,然后提取键以及提取值。 涉及API: (3)方式三:lambda表达式 得益于JDK8开始的新技术Lambda表达式,提供了一 … WebSep 8, 2024 · You can sort a Map like a HashMap, LinkedHashMap, or TreeMap in Java 8 by using the sorted () method of java.util.stream.Stream class. This means accepts a Comparator, which can be used for sorting. If you want to sort by values then you can simply use the comparingByValue () method of the Map.Entry class.
WebJan 10, 2024 · HashMap iteration with forEach() In the first example, we use Java 8 forEach method to iterate over the key-value pairs of the HashMap. The forEach method performs the given action for each element of the map until all elements have been … WebMar 6, 2024 · HashMap is a part of Java’s collection since Java 1.2. This class is found in java.util package. It provides the basic implementation of the Map interface of Java. It stores the data in (Key, Value) pairs, and you can access them by an index of another type (e.g. an Integer). One object is used as a key (index) to another object (value).
WebJun 30, 2009 · Since all maps in Java implement the Map interface, the following techniques will work for any map implementation (HashMap, TreeMap, LinkedHashMap, Hashtable, etc.) Method #1 : Iterating over entries using a For-Each loop. WebMar 11, 2024 · Map nameMap = new HashMap <> (); Integer value = nameMap.computeIfAbsent ( "John", s -> s.length ()); In this case, we will calculate a value by applying a function to a key, put inside a map, and also returned from a method call. We may replace the lambda with a method reference that matches passed and returned …
WebMay 3, 2014 · Now Java 8 release provides a new way to loop through Map in Java using Stream API and forEach method. For now, we will see 3 ways to loop through each element of Map . Though Map is an interface in Java, we often loop through common Map implementation like HashMap , Hashtable , TreeMap, and LinkedHashMap .
pack food for disney world vacationWebNov 26, 2024 · There are several ways to print all the keys and value from the hashmap. Let's see one by one - 1. We want to print all the keys: Set keys = productPrice.keySet (); //print all the keys... pack football manager 2021WebNov 20, 2024 · How to iterate all mappings of HashMap using forEach? (Java 8 and later) If you are using Java 8 or later version, you can use the forEach to iterate over all the mappings of the HashMap as given below. jerma real heightWebJul 30, 2024 · 8 Best ways to Iterate through HashMap in Java. Method 1. Iterate through a HashMap EntrySet using Iterator. Map interface didn’t extend a Collection interface and hence it will not have its own iterator. entrySet () returns a Set and a Set interface which … pack food for backpackingWebApr 11, 2024 · 8 使用Lambda表达式: List list = Arrays.asList("apple", "banana", "orange"); List filteredList = list.stream().filter(fruit -> fruit.startsWith("a")).map(String::toUpperCase).sorted().collect(Collectors.toList()); 1 2 滕青山YYDS 滕青山YYDS 码龄7年 Java领域优质创作者 pack football teamWebNov 22, 2024 · HashMap is one of the implementations of the Map interface. HashMap is widely used in the realtime applications to store the key-value pair. This supports all kinds of operations needed on a daily … pack football twitterWebApr 11, 2024 · 2.4 list.forEach list.forEach(name ->{ System.out.println(name); }); 1; 2; 3; 这种方法是Java 8 特有的方式封装在集合的方法。 以上都可以遍历出结果: 3.总结. 前三种方式是外部迭代:我们编写如何控制集合的迭代。 第四种是内部迭代:我们编写每次迭代 … jerma scout tf2